Work History
05/2021 to Current
CPC/CEDC Northside Hospital Stockbridge, GA,
  • Interacted with physicians and other healthcare staff to ask questions regarding patient services.
  • Reviewed outpatient records and interpreted documentation to identify diagnoses and procedures.
  • Reviewed, analyzed and managed coding of diagnostic and treatment procedures contained in outpatient medical records.
  • Resourcefully used various coding books, procedure manuals and on-line encoders.
  • Utilized active listening, interpersonal and telephone etiquette skills when communicating with others.
  • Applied official coding conventions and rules from AMA, VHA, and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services to assign diagnostic codes.
  • Correctly coded and billed medical claims for various hospital and outpatient facilities/specialties.
  • Accurately selected proper descriptive code when more than one anatomical location was indicated.
  • Verified signatures and checked medical charts for accuracy and completion.
  • Guarded against fraud and abuse by verifying coded data accurately reflected services provided.
  • Used 3M to assign procedure and diagnostic codes to patient records for billing purposes.
  • Performed billing and coding procedures for ambulance, emergency room, impatient and outpatient services.
